The reposado rests in used American whiskey barrels for 6 months. A strong base from the Blanco delivers slight aromas of agave, pepper, and fruits. The whiskey oaking is robust with aromas of oak, spices, and honey. These aromas are followed by strong oak and spices on the palate with lingering flashes of agave. The hint of honey is present on the finish with lingering notes of oak and spice as well. Not confirmed additive free.
About this bottle
Flecha Azul is a 100% blue weber agave tequila brand founded by Mexican pro golfer Abraham Ancer and entrepreneur Aron Marquez. In 2022, actor/producer Mark Wahlberg joined the team as its principal investor. Made in Jalisco, Mexico, ripe agaves are cooked in brick ovens and fermented for 72 hours. Then the fermented juice is double distilled and for the reposado tequila is then aged in American oak ex-bourbon barrels for six months before bottling.
